    I can say from experience that being a mom is harder than any job we will ever have. It requires more patience than our teenage years combined. We worry, we stress and we have moments of complete chaos that require us to stay calm and be leaders. 

    Even when we want to fold under pressure or give up and QUIT. We can't. Even when we want to cry and crawl in a closet and just lock the door. 

    WE CAN'T. 

    There is no other job like being a mother - full of often impossible tasks. 

    But, we are committed to this parenting thing because of LOVE. 

    I will never forget a wonderful yoga class I took a few months ago. The final words of the hour stuck with me: "may the rest of your day be peaceful and calm!" I left thinking YEAH RIGHT! Because after any workout I go home to 2 wild boys and the last thing I am is calm.

    But I decided it was time for me to try and be calm. Instead of my usual go-go, hurry hurry, rush rush, scream yell, bribe, coerce  etc. I chose to be extra sweet, give lots of hugs, be playful, happy, smiling, and gentle with a calm voice and peaceful attitude. Even when the S**!t hit the fan, I still kept my composure. Even when I was being screamed at while talking on important phone calls, I remained sweet. 

    My youngest is a little love bug. And whenever he does things he's not supposed to do or is throwing a tantrum I tend to get upset. He always cries even more after that and says "be happy mom. I just want you to be happy!"

    And then my heart melts. We hug it out and we say sorry. And then I realize that all my kids {all kids} really want is for their parents to be in good moods, to listen to them, play with them and give lots of hugs and kisses.

    Things are so much better at my house when I am peaceful. When I stick to it, ask things nicely, say please, thank you, sorry.and all with a smile, I notice the respect I give cames right back. 

    When I treat my littles ones the way I like to be treated, I notice they are MUCH kinder, calmer, happy, peaceful, spirited and can concentrate better. They act less tired, mischievous, crabby and cranky. 

    It doesn't happen overnight. And it doesn't happen everyday or as often as I'd like. But the best part about kids is they forgive. So quickly. Most of the time I do lose my cool and I do yell and I do feel like a total failure {that's part of being a parent and our life lessons}. But when I dig deep and remember my youngest sons cry for my happiness or I look at that artwork on the wall - I am reminded to start over and find that patience, that calmness - it's in there.

    If you haven’t made this cold lentil salad yet you’re missing out. It’s tangy (lemon) and full of protein (plant protein). Perfect for a pot luck. Or snack on it for a few days. 
INGREDIENTS
3 cups cooked lentils (cold)
1 whole lemon, juiced
1/2 tsp sea salt
1/2 tap cumin
3 Tbsp dried parsley
1/4 cup olive oil
1/2 zucchini (julienned)
1/4 red onion (Finley chopped)
DIRECTIONS
Mix everything in a bowl. Enjoy.

    Damn this combo of garlic, ginger and tahini over sautéed potatoes is 💣. I love tahini dressing because of how creamy it gets without using cashews or dairy products. I first sautéed the potatoes in vegan butter. I added a few shallots for fun. THAT’S IT. If you cut them thin enough they cook in just 5-6 minutes on medium high heat. I added raw kale to them for added fiber and minerals. 
Dressing 
2 cloves garlic
1/4 inch piece of fresh ginger
1 whole lemon
2-3 Tbsp sesame oil, 
1 heaping Tbsp tahini
2 Tbsp water
big pinch sea salt. 
blend it all together until creamy and chunk-free. 
Enjoy

    🍌🍌🍌As you can see I have been on a crepes binge lately!This time I’m making sweet crepes. Need to use up your overly ripe bananas? This is the recipe for you! 
Batter
2 ripe bananas
1 1/2 c gf flour
2 Tbsp apple cider vinegar
1 cup water 
Blend on high until batter is creamy and smooth. Pour batter onto bubbling hot greased frying pan. Make sure the batter is thinly spread. Let that cook well. Flip when ready. Flip another couple times and repeat. 
Add filling of our choice. I used chocolate chips and maple syrup. 
Delicious and healthy! What will you put inside your crepes?
